Summary of dreams of freedom by Diana castillo
In the book “Dreams of freedom” by Castillo D. we’re shown a very tragic story that tells how the second world war was taking place in Munich, Germany. Our main characters named Emma and her mother Silvia used to live in Jerusalem for 10 years. Emma was a young, thin and blonde little girl. One day Emma left her home heading towards her school, while on her way there, a german policeman captures her. The german policeman brought her to a group of Jews that were going to the concentration camp named Dachau. When the group arrived, the german policemen gave them a tour around the whole camp. After this, Emma’s group were given some uniforms with ID numbers attached to them. A few days later, Emma meets Annette and they quickly became best friends, some time after this Emma met a police officer named Oswald and one night they made a plan to escape Dachau together with Annette. They day the scape was planned Emma remembers that she left her photo album behind and is captured by the officers of Dachau when she went back to look for it. The next day after the scape of her friends she was executed by hanging in front of all Dachau’s Jews.
